TRAFFIC CONTROL ASSISTANT

This position is in the Department of Public Works - Infrastructure Services Division and will be filled on a full-time temporary basis for 12 - 15 weeks during the summer. An employee in this position may continue to work afterwards on a part-time basis averaging 20 hours a week dependent on the needs of the Department. However, each position is limited to 1,040 hours per year and is not eligible for benefits.

PURPOSE:

  • Under the general direction of the Traffic and Lighting Engineer, performs traffic studies and compiles and analyzes data related to various transportation facilities.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

  • Compile and analyze data on the availability and use of pedestrian, roadway, bicycle, and parking facilities
  • Calculate peak flow rates, average speeds and travel time, and perform other relevant computations.
  • Assist in maintaining and updating a computerized database(s) of traffic and facilities information.
  • Create maps and other relevant data summaries using a CADD system or other software.
  • Prepare inputs for "traffic signal optimization" software and assist with the interpretation of model results.
  • Perform other related duties as assigned.

NOTE: Other equipment used to perform this job includes hand calculator and digital traffic recorder.

M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S:

  1. Status as a college student in a civil engineering program from a school of engineering whose program is accredited by the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ology (ABET), who has successfully completed college level course work in math and engineering related studies; students with an interest in Traffic or Transportation Engineering are preferred.
    •  College transcripts must be submitted with the application.
  2. Possession of a valid Motor Vehicle Operator's License at time of appointment and throughout employment.
  3. Residence in the City of Milwaukee within six months of appointment.

K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ES REQUIRED:

  • Willingness and ability to perform outdoor work which may involve a moderate degree of walking and stair climbing.
    • Successful candidates will be required to pass a medical screening prior to appointment.
  • Ability to work independently and in collaboration with others.
  • Knowledge and experience with CADD systems and other engineering, spreadsheet or database software are desired.
